Centri review
A few days ago Mike dropped one of his Centri machines off to me to try out, here's my thoughts on it. I can't really compare it to any rotary I have used before or even a coil machine. To me it has a feel that's all its own. the Give on it reminded of a cars suspension almost, adjusting to the skin like a car adjust to terrain. Here is a breakdown of my feeling on the machine.
Its a very good machine all around, for packing , shading fanning anything you want it to do it will do. Hits nice and soft when you want it to but give the power to put in deeply saturation color if you want also.
It surprisingly light for it size and appearance and the customers i used it on said it hurt less then my Stigmas I normally use. As far as performance goes it gets the job done nicely.
Now on to what I disliked about the machine.
I didnt not care for how the rubberband set up is. Putting the rubberband on is alot more hassle then it should be in my opinion. And the vibration is very noticable, more then any other machine I use. Not saying u can't get use to this vibration but I prefer to not have to.
With that being said I think the machine is a good machine on performance alone and with a few design changes can become a great machine. Mike is on to something here I think. Keep it up and very interested to see future renditions of this machine as he improves upon his design.
